Black Wednesday: Websites Go Dark For SOPA Protest (PHOTOS)
( Source: Huffington Post )

More than 7,000 websites — including Wikipedia and Google — went dark Jan. 18 to protest anti-piracy legislation currently making its way through the U.S. Congress. Sites in opposition either… READ MORE

SOPA Generates 2.4M Tweets; Who Says It Limits Online Expression?
( Source: Reuters )

Who says SOPA limits online expression? It generated 2.4 million tweets on Wednesday as people shut out from Wikipedia and other sites turned to Twitter to vent their frustration with the… READ MORE
